Key Changes to the MLS Playoff Structure
In a groundbreaking update, Major League Soccer (MLS) has announced an alteration to its playoff format designed to accommodate an increasing number of teams. The new system is set to bring additional excitement to the postseason by allowing more clubs to vie for the championship.
Details of the New Format
- Increased Participation: The playoff structure will now permit more teams to compete, enhancing the competitive landscape of the league.
- Elimination Round: The format includes an initial knockout stage where lower-seeded teams will battle for a chance to advance.
- Home-Field Advantage: Higher-seeded squads will have the benefit of hosting matches, contributing to an elevated home-crowd atmosphere.
Implications for the League
This adaptation reflects the league’s growth and commitment to offering thrilling soccer experiences. By expanding the postseason format, MLS aims to generate more interest and engagement among fans, ensuring that the competition remains fierce and dynamic.
